Zelestia (Japanese: セレスティア Selestia) is a character in Fire Emblem Engage, made available via downloadable content. She is the captain of the Four Winds and a parallel universe version of Zephia.

Biography


This section has been marked as a stub. Please help improve the page by adding information.


Zelestia is a scion of a parallel Elyos' Mage Dragon tribe, who was born with low magical power compared to her kin. In her universe's Fell Dragon War, Sombron attempted to subjugate the Mage Dragon clan only to end up killing its members, leaving Zelestia as the only survivor due to her low power concealing her presence. Afterwards, she met Lumera and became one of her main allies, and after her and Alear's demise against Sombron in two separate wars later on, she went on to serve Nel and Nil, and form the Four Winds along with Mauvier, Gregory, and Madeline.

Fire Emblem Engage

Role

Zelestia is a playable unit during the Fell Xenologue who is available in Chapters 2, 3, 4, and 6. She's also automatically recruited in the main story upon completing the side story.

Endings

Loving Leader Zelestia
Zelestia set out to find Mage Dragons rumored to be living in secret. She was often confused for Zephia of the Four Hounds, but her kindness won through.
In later years, she became leader of the new Mage Dragon village and lived out her life loving them, and loved by them, as family.

Divine Dragon Alear & Loving Leader Zelestia
Alear became the new Divine Dragon Monarch. His/Her bonds with the rulers of each nation resulted in lasting peace.
Zelestia showered the people of Lythos with affection while supporting the Divine Dragon. The two enjoyed meals together for over a thousand happy years.

Etymology and other languages


This section has been marked as a stub. Please help improve the page by adding information.


Names, etymology, and in other regions
Language Name Definition, etymology, and notes
English

Zelestia

Corruption of "Celestia", a name of Latin origin derived from caelestis, "heavenly".

Japanese

セレスティア

Officially romanized as Selestia.
